The exporter may claim RoSL rates for export of garments, garments under AA-AIR and made-ups textiles articles which are being hereby notified as Schedules-I, II and III respectively of this Notification provided he shall have to give an undertaking that he has not claimed or shall not claim credit/rebate/refund/reimbursement of these specific State Levies under any other mechanism.
Casual taxable person: Means a person who occasionally undertakes transactions involving supply of goods or services in course or furtherance of business, whether as an agent, principal or otherwise, in a State, UT where he has no fixed place of business.
